JOB

SUMMARY

The Sunnyside Assistant Store Manager is responsible for assisting in the management of all day‑to‑day operations of the dispensary in accordance with state law and Company standards. This position will provide support and oversight of all dispensary staff, including talent selection, training, coaching, development, and enforcing adherence to standard operating procedures. The Assistant Store Manager should champion a strong culture that aligns with the company’s core values and mission to normalize, professionalize, and revolutionize cannabis.

The Assistant Manager is responsible for inventory management, building customer loyalty, ensuring compliance with state regulations, and maintaining a safe and clean work environment.

R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Develop, coach, and inspire employees to achieve individual and team goals through regular feedback and career development planning.
  • Assist Human Resources and leadership in managing employee relations issues.
  • Participate in staffing and recruiting efforts.
  • Create and communicate an effective weekly labor schedule.
  • Respond to employee questions, concerns or suggestions and communicate resource needs to management.
  • Communicate regulatory changes and their implications to staff.
  • Ensure a clean and safe environment for employees and customers.
  • Facilitate training and onboarding of team members, including coaching on selling and cross‑selling techniques.
  • Perform store opening and closing procedures such as register preparation, morning and closing inventory, inventory reconciliation and reporting.
  • Manage and delegate daily operations while navigating operational challenges and escalations.
  • Create and deliver accurate recaps and reports to management.
  • Resolve any escalated cash, POS or product discrepancies.
  • Maintain accurate records of all dispensary activities including daily cash reconciliations, customer records, sales, deliveries and returns.
  • Support outreach efforts/community partnerships to build a positive image within the community, drive brand awareness, and draw new patients.
  • Ensure compliance to all company policies, procedures, state and local laws.
  • Assist management and Compliance teams in any state inspections or audits.
  • Experience leading and managing a team of hourly members; skills include recruiting, onboarding, training, managing employee relations and coaching.
  • The opportunity to build on retail business fundamentals to include effective scheduling, identifying sales trends, and business writing & reporting.
  • Skills in conflict resolution, self‑discipline, critical thinking and problem solving.
  • Skills in interviewing, talent selection and talent management of hourly team members.
